China has witnessed a sharp rise in the number of ultra-wealthy individuals over the past year, driven by a robust stock market and the rapid growth of “new economy” sectors, according to the Hurun Research Institute.
The institute’s latest China Rich List recorded a total of 1,434 individuals, each with a net worth of at least 5 billion yuan (US$702 million, an increase of 340 people, or 31%, from the previous year. Collectively, their wealth reached 30 trillion yuan, marking a 42% surge compared with last year.
